PLEASE HURRY! When two fractions less than 1 are divided, is their quotient always, sometimes or never greater than 1? Explain.

Respuesta :

CrazyBun
CrazyBun CrazyBun
  • 02-12-2021
Answer: Sometimes

Explanation:

Quotient greater than 1:

3/4 divide by 2/3
= 3/4 x 3/2 = 9/8 > 1

4/5 divide by 2/5
= 4/5 x 5/2 = 2 > 1

Quotient less than 1

1/100 divide by 2/10
= 1/100 x 10/2 = 1/20 < 1

1/50 divide by 1/25
= 1/50 x 25/1 = 1/2 < 1
